Solution

The correct option is A

Lamp black


Explanation for correct option A:

Lamp black or carbon black or soot are black particles of carbon present in flame when hydrocarbons, petroleum or substance rich in carbon content are heated in the limited supply of air. So soot is lamp black.

Explanation for incorrect

Option B:

Charcoal is formed when wood is burnt in the absence of air.It is of various wood charcoal,bone charcoal and sugar charcoal.So soot is not included in this category.

Option C:

Coke is the purest form of carbon and is produced when coal is strongly burnt in the absence of air. We get coke as a residue.

Option D:

Graphite is the allot ropy of carbon and softest mineral known with metallic lustre and greasy feel.

Thus, Lamp black or carbon black is soot when hydrocarbons,petroleum or substance rich in carbon content are heated in the limited supply of air.So soot is lamp black.
